(^TOTICE.— There will be an anchor and •'J^ : • chain! i and libel, attached, oni .the South Spit, and boat and boat's crew in readiness at high- water," every tide, to assist any vessel coming over the bar. When the bar is only fit for steamers to take, a red flag -will be hoisted on the north flagstaff. "Vyhen for Bailing vessels, a red flag and ball.' Masters .of vessels are particularly requested to attend to the small' tidal flag on the spit, as the small tidal flag and the largo flag in one takes them over the bar By order, i ; J. KERLEY, Harbor Master. THE PADDOCK, LAKE BRUNNER STATION.
